Auditoria.AI has successfully raised $38 million in a Series B funding round aimed at expanding its innovative agentic artificial intelligence solutions tailored for enterprise finance teams. This significant investment underscores the growing demand for advanced AI technologies in the financial sector, as companies seek to streamline operations and improve decision-making processes.
The funds will be utilized to further develop Auditoria.AI's platform, which leverages machine learning and natural language processing to automate various financial tasks. By enhancing its capabilities, Auditoria.AI aims to empower finance professionals, allowing them to focus on strategic initiatives rather than routine data management.
The investment round attracted notable participation from various investors, reflecting confidence in Auditoria.AI's vision and potential for growth. As the financial landscape continues to evolve, the integration of sophisticated AI tools is becoming increasingly essential for organizations striving to maintain a competitive edge and enhance operational efficiency.
